  • Purpose: This study was done for the purpose of testing the effects of hand moxibustion on pain in the knee joint, range of motion of the knee, and discomfort during ADL in elderly persons with knee joint pain. Method: Nonequivalent control group pre-post test research design was used. The participants were 35 elders who had knee joint pain. Sixteen were assigned to the experimental group and 19 to the control group. The instruments used for this study were the CRS (Graphic rating scale) for knee joint pain, goniometer for knee joint ROM, and modified ADL questionnaire developed by Lee. Analysis of data was done by percents, means and standard deviation, $x^2$-test, t-test, and ANCOVA using SPSS WIN 10.0. Result: The pain score for the right knee joint after hand moxibustion was significantly different between the experimental group and the control group after hand moxibustion (p=.035). The pain score for the left knee joint was not significantly different between the experimental group and the control group after hand moxibustion (p=.075). Right and left knee ROM scores were significantly different between the experimental group and the control group after hand moxibustion (Right p=.000, Left p=.034). Discomfort of ADL score was not significantly different between the experimental group and the control group after hand moxibustion (p=.053). Conclusion: In summary, knee joint pain in elders after hand moxibustion decreased and knee ROM in elders after hand moxibustion increased. So it would be useful for nurses to provide hand moxibustion as an alternative therapy to elders with knee joint pain in the community and thus reduce joint pain and increase knee ROM.

  • Solution processed conjugated molecules enable to manufacture various electronic devices by unconventional and cost effective patterning methods as screen or gravure printing. Spin-coating is the most popularly used method to form conjugated polymeric film for various electronic devices. The coating method has certain disadvantages such as a large amount of unwanted wastes, difficulty forming a film with a large area, and impossible to apply roll-to-roll manufacturing. We present here a promising alternative coating method, bar-coating for conjugated polymer film and OLED with the bar coated light emitting layer. In this papers, we show atomic force microscope images of spin- and bar-coated Poly[(9,9-di-n-octylfluorenyl-2,7-diyl)-alt-(benzo[2,1,3]thiadiazol-4,8-diyl)] (F8BT) films on substrate. The bar-coated film showed a slight lower RMS roughness (1.058 [nm]) than spin-coated film (1.767 [nm]). It means the bar-coating is suitable method to form light emitting layers in OLEDs. By using bar-coating process, an OLED obtained with 4.7 [cd/A] in maximum current efficiency.

  • This research aimed to investigate the effect of business management of Korean restaurants on business performance and to propose an alternative. For this investigation, a survey was carried out targeting Korean restaurant managers in the capital area, and with 360 copies as sample, factor analysis, difference test, and multiple regression analysis were conducted. As a result of analysis, among the factors of business management of Korean restaurants, only information management and fund management appeared to have effects on both financial performance and nonfinancial performance. This means, in case of Korean restaurants, business performance can be improved by understanding every environment about food service management and customer demands, by investing fund in the right place, and by managing inefficient expenses. Therefore, it is most important for a Korean restaurant manager to cultivate knowledge in management and to put effort into cost-reduction of all employees.

  • Petroleum based fossil fuels used to power most processes today are non-renewable fuels. This means that once used, they cannot be reproduced for a very long time. The maximum combustion of fossil fuels occurs in automobiles i.e. the vehicles we drive every day. Thus, there is a requirement to shift from these non-renenewable sources of energy to sources that are renewable and environment friendly. This is causing the need to shift towards more environmentally-sustainable transport fuels, preferably derived from biomass, such as biodiesel blends. These blends can be made from oils that are available in abundance or as waste e.g. waste cooking oil, animal fat, oil from seeds, oil from algae etc. Waste Cooking Oil(WCO) is a waste product and so, converting it into a transportation fuel is considered highly environmentally sustainable. Keeping this in mind, a life cycle assessment (LCA) was performed to evaluate the environmental implications of replacing diesel fuel with WCO biodiesel blends in a regular Diesel engine. This study uses Life Cycle Assessment (LCA) to determine the environmental outcomes of biodiesel from WCO in terms of global warming potential, life cycle energy efficiency (LCEE) and fossil energy ratio (FER) using the life cycle inventory and the openLCA software, version 1.3.4: 2007 - 2013 GreenDelta. This study resulted in the conclusion that the biodiesel production process from WCO in particular is more environmentally sustainable as compared to the preparation of diesel from raw oil, also taking into account the combustion products that are released into the atmosphere as exhaust emissions.

  • In developing information systems, conceptual modeling is among the most fundamental means. The importance attributed to conceptual modeling has not only given rise to a lot of modeling methods, but also to the "yet another modeling approach (YAMA)" syndrome and the "not another modeling approach (NAMA)" hysteria. Criticism of conceptual modeling methods usually targets their lacking of theoretical foundations. In response to such criticism, various approaches towards theoretical foundations of conceptual modeling have been proposed so far. One of the recent responses to the quest for theoretical foundations of conceptual modeling is the reference to the philosophical ontology. The currently most prominent of diverse approaches towards ontological foundations of conceptual modeling appears to be the Bunge-Wand-Weber (BWW) ontology. Recent approaches attempt to regard BWW ontology as another conceptual data model as well as a criterion for evaluating various conceptual models. However, unfortunately, relatively few researches have been made on interoperability between the Entity-Relationship (ER) model, which is the most dominant conceptual data model, and ontology based model. In this paper, we investigate the interoperability between ontology and the ER model. In detail we (i) reclassify components of ER model with respect to ontology concepts, (ii) identify some components that cannot be directly represented in ontology notation, and (iii) present alternative representations to the components to acquire ontologically clear ER diagrams. Additionally, we (iv) present a set of mapping rules for converting the ontologically clear ER diagram into the corresponding ontology. In a case study, we show the process of converting an ER diagram for a concise Project Management System (PMS) into the ontologically clear ER diagram and the corresponding ontology. We also describe an experiment that we undertook to test whether users understand the Ontologically-Clear ER diagram better.

  • Bio-hydrogenation of $C_{18}$-unsaturated fatty acids released from the hydrolysis of dietary lipids in the rumen, in general, occurs rapidly but the range of hydrogenation is quite large, depending on the degree of unsaturation of fatty acids, the configuration of unsaturated fatty acids, microbial type and the experimental condition. Conjugated linoleic acid (CLA) is incompletely hydrogenated products by rumen microorganisms in ruminant animals. It has been shown to have numerous potential benefits for human health and the richest dietary sources of CLA are bovine milk and milk products. The cis-9, trans-11 is the predominant CLA isomer in bovine products and other isomers can be formed with double bonds in positions 8/10, 10/12, or 11/13. The term CLA refers to this whole group of 18 carbon conjugated fatty acids. Alpha-linolenic acid goes through a similar bio-hydrogenation process producing trans-11 $C_{18:1}$ and $C_{18:0}$, but may not appear to produce CLA as an intermediate. Although the CLA has been mostly derived from the dietary $C_{18:2}$ alternative pathway may be existed due to the extreme microbial diversity in the reticulo-rumen. Regardless of the origin of CLA, manipulation of the bio-hydrogenation process remains the key to increasing CLA in milk and beef by dietary means, by increasing rumen production of CLA. Although the effect of oil supplementation on changes in fatty acid composition in milk seems to be clear its effect on beef is still controversial. Thus further studies are required to enrich the CLA in beef under various dietary and feeding conditions.

  • Massage therapy is a traditional, alternative and nonphamacological means of promoting rest and relaxation. However, nursing intervention by massage for middle-aged women is rarely practiced by nurses. The purpose of this research was to examine the effects of the hand and arm massage as an independent nursing intervention tool for middle- aged women. The data used in this research were collected from forty-nine subjects using a nonequivalent control group non- synchronized design. Twenty-four persons for the experimental group and Twenty-five persons for the control group were selected from D city and C city from July 1997 to September 2000. Subjects' ages were between forty and fifty-six years old with mean the age of 45.6. Hand and arm massage developed by Cayce and Reilly was applied to the experimental group for a session of 15 minutes two or three times a week for four weeks. The instruments used for the measurement of the subjects' stress, anxiety, depression and the middle-life crisis were Langners's 22-item Self-rating Depression Scale, and Kim's Middle Life Crisis Scale(1988). These psychological factors were measured before and after the implementation of hand and arm massage. The data were analyzed with mean$\pm$s.d, percent, t-test, and a paired t-test. The results were summarized as follows; 1. Before the treatment, there were no significant differences between the two groups. 2. After the treatment, there were significant differences in the stress and the occurrence of mid life crisis between the two groups. The findings suggest that the use of the life crisis. Therefore, it is recommended that hand and arm massage be used as an independent nursing intervention tool for middle-aged women. For further research, is needed replication of this concept of research with different subjects in a larger population. Also, it is recommended to investigate the effects of massage with aroma therapy for the berefit of decreasing womens' stress level further.

  • This study explores the means by which MX can be effectively extracted from chlorinated water 3-Chloro-4-(dichloromethyl)-5-hydroxy-2(5H)-furanone (MX), a potent mutagen commonly found in chlorinated drinking water at concentrations of up to a few hundred ng/L, was quantitatively determined using sample enrichment followed by liquid-liquid extraction (LLE), derivatization to methylated form, and analysis with GC-MS. A 4-L water sample was enriched to a concentration of 0.4 L using a vacuum rotary evaporator at 30 ℃. MX in the water was extracted using ethyl acetate (100 mL × 2) as a solvent and MX in the extract was methylated with 10 % H2SO4 in methanol. MX was recovered at a rate of 73.8 %, which was higher than that (38.1 %) for the resin adsorption method. The limit of quantification and repeatability (as relative standard deviation) were estimated to be 10 ng/L and 2.2 %, respectively. This result suggested that LLE can be used for the determination of MX in chlorinated water as an alternative to more time-consuming resin adsorption method.
